One of the biggest problems we have with this place is that NO ONE can ever find it!
I think the house number is to blame.
Could you read that from the road?
I didn't think so.
So here's what I made.
I kind of think it's adorable.
It's so simple, but I love the look it gives our front door.
Our door versus the neighbors
I used a drop cloth, a template I cut out of some cardboard, my cricut and some stitch witch.
I traced the numbers and colored them in with a teal sharpie.
I wasn't really sure if this would work, but I actually really like it.
